Scandium

Transition Metal

Scandium (Sc) is a chemical element with atomic number 21, classified as a transition metal. At room temperature it is a solid. It was discovered in 1879 by Lars Fredrik Nilson.

Properties

Atomic number
21
Atomic mass
44.956 u
Category
Transition Metal
Group
3
Period
4
Block
d-block
Electron configuration
[Ar] 3d¹ 4s²
Phase at STP
Solid
Density
2.989 g/cm³
Melting point
1814 K (1540.8 °C)
Boiling point
3109 K (2835.8 °C)
Electronegativity
1.36
Atomic radius
184 pm
Ionization energy
6.561 eV
Discovery
1879 · Lars Fredrik Nilson

Common uses

Aerospace alloys, high-intensity lights, baseball bats
